#39981d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#39981d is composed of 22.4% red, 59.6% green and 11.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 80.9% yellow and 40.4% black. It has a hue angle of 106.3 degrees, a saturation of 68% and a lightness of 35.5%. #39981d color hex could be obtained by blending #72ff3a with #003100.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

#39981d color description : Dark lime green.

#39981d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#39981d has RGB values of R:57, G:152, B:29 and CMYK values of C:0.63, M:0, Y:0.81,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 3774493.

Shades and Tints of #39981d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010401 is the darkest color, while #f5fdf2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#39981d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#576055 is the less saturated color, while #2ab401 is the most saturated one.
